Реферат Курсовая Конспект
Работа сделанна в 1999 году
Реляционные Базы Данных. SQL - стандартный язык реляционных баз данных - Реферат, раздел Программирование, - 1999 год - Санкт-Петербургский Государственный Технический Университет Факультет Эконом...
|
Санкт-Петербургский Государственный Технический Университет Факультет Экономики и Менеджмента Кафедра Мировая Экономика РЕФЕРАТ По Информатике на тему Реляционные Базы Данных.SQL - стандартный язык реляционных баз данных Выполнил Егоров С. Н. гр.2 Проверил Первицкий А. Ю. Санкт- Петербург 1999 Содержание Содержание 1. Реляционные базы данных 3 Что такое базы данных? 3 Первые модели данных 3 Системы управления файлами 3 Иерархические СУБД 4 Сетевые базы данных 5 Реляционная модель данных 7 Таблицы 8 Первичные ключи 9 Отношения предок потомок 10 Внешние ключи 11 Двенадцать правил Кодда 12 2. Язык SQL как стандартный язык баз данных 14 Язык SQL 15 Роль SQL 16 Достоинства SQL 17 Независимость от конкретных СУБД 18 Переносимость с одной вычислительной системы на другую 18 Стандарты языка SQL 18 Одобрение SQL компанией IBM DB19 Протокол ODBC и компания Microsoft 19 Реляционная основа 19 Высокоуровневая структура, напоминающая английский язык 20 Интерактивные запросы 20 Программный доступ к базе данных 20 Различные представления данных 20 Полноценный язык для работы с базами данных 20 Динамическое определение данных 21 Архитектура клиент сервер 3. Стандарты SQL 21 I ISO 21 Другие стандарты SQL 22 ODBC и консорциум SQL Access Group 23 Миф о переносимости 4. Влияние SQL 25 SQL и спецификация SAA компании IBM 25 SQL на мини-компьютерах 26 SQL на системах UNIX 26 SQL и обработка транзакций 26 SQL на персональных компьютерах 27 SQL в локальных сетях 28 Список использованной литературы 30 1. Реляционные базы данных Что такое базы данных? В самом общем смысле база данных - это набор записей и файлов, организованных специальным образом.
В компьютере, например, можно хранить фамилии и адреса друзей или клиентов.
Один из типов баз данных - это документы, набранные с помощью текстовых редакторов и сгруппированные по темам.
Другой тип - файлы электронных таблиц, объединяемые в группы по характеру их использования.
Первые модели данных С ростом популярности СУБД в 70-80-х годах появилось множество различных моделей данных.
У каждой из них имелись свои достоинства и недостатки, которые сыграли ключевую роль в развитии реляционной модели данных, появившейся во многом благодаря стремлению упростить и упорядочить первые модели данных.
Знание о содержимом файла - какие данные в нём хранятся и какова их ст... Для такой системы файл, содержащий документ текстового процессора, нич... В основе СУБД лежала простая идея изъять из программ определение струк... В системах управления файлами модели данных, как правило, не использов... 1.
Например, машина состоит из двигателя, корпуса и ходовой части двигате... К сожалению, практическое определение понятия реляционная база данных ... На первый взгляд, первичным ключом таблицы OFFICES могут служить и сто... Правило 3 требует, чтобы отсутствующие данные можно было представить с... 2.
На сегодняшний день SQL поддерживают свыше ста СУБД, работающих как на... Согласно этой схеме, в вычислительной системе имеется база данных, в к... Операторы SQL встраиваются в базовый язык, например COBOL, FORTRAN или... В большинстве новых приложений используется архитектура клиент сервер,... Программное обеспечение каждой системы посредством использования SQL с...
Достоинства SQL SQL - это легкий для понимания язык и в то же время универсальное программное средство управления данными. Успех языку SQL принесли следующие его особенности независимость от конкретных СУБД
Переносимость с одной вычислительной системы на другую. наличие стандартов одобрение компанией IBM СУБД DB2 поддержка со сторо... Ниже эти факторы рассмотрены более подробно. Независимость от конкретн... Реляционную базу данных и программы, которые с ней работают, можно пер... Таким образом, SQL обеспечивает независимость от конкретных СУБД, что ...
Стандарты языка SQL. Официальный стандарт языка SQL был опубликован Американским институтом... Кроме того, SQL является федеральным стандартом США по обработке инфор... SQL Access Group - консорциум поставщиков компьютерного оборудования и... Все основные семейства компьютеров компании IBM поддерживают SQL систе...
Компания Microsoft рассматривает доступ к базам данных как важную част... Высокоуровневая структура, напоминающая английский язык Операторы SQL ... Реляционная основа SQL является языком реляционных баз данных, поэтому... На волне популярности, вызванной успехом реляционной модели, SQL стал ... В результате большинство операторов SQL означают именно то, что точно ...
Из-за того, что SQL допускает немедленные запросы, данные становятся б... Интерактивные запросы. SQL является языком интерактивных запросов, который обеспечивает польз...
Одни и те же операторы SQL используются как для интерактивного, так и ... Программный доступ к базе данных. Программисты пользуются языком SQL, чтобы писать приложения, в которых... В традиционных базах данных для программного доступа используются одни...
Кроме того, данные из различных частей базы данных могут быть скомбини... Различные представления данных. С помощью SQL создатель базы может сделать так, что различные пользова... Например, базу данных можно спроектировать таким образом, что каждый п...
Полноценный язык для работы с базами данных. SQL является полноценным и логичным языком, предназначенным для создан... Первоначально SQL был задуман как язык интерактивных запросов, но сейч...
Обычно при упоминании стандарта SQL имеют в виду официальный стандарт,... В отличие от стандарта 1989 года, проект SQL2 предусматривал возможнос... В то время, как первый стандарт 1986 года занимает не более ста страни... Вопреки стандарту SQL2, во всех существующих на сегодняшний день комме... Более того, поставщики СУБД включают в свои продукты новые возможности...
Однако компания выпустила реализацию DB2 и для OS 2собственной операци... Прозрачность взаимодействия между различными базами данных остается ил... Тем не менее, второй стандарт от SQL Access Group имеет на рынке больш... В результате настойчивых требований компании Microsoft, консорциум SQL... В этом же году была опубликована собственная спецификация ODBC Open Da...
Детали наименования баз данных и первоначального подключения к ним сил... Этот способ не используется ни в одном коммерческом продукте, а в суще... 4. Появление стандарта SQL вызвало довольно много восторженных заявлений ... .
По мере того как отдельные персональные компьютеры уступают дорогу сет... SQL применяется даже при оперативной обработке транзакций, опровергая ... Влияние SQL. Будучи стандартным языком доступа к реляционной базе данных, SQL оказы...
SQL 400. Эта реализация SQL для систем среднего уровня поддерживает встроенную ... Эта реализация DB2 работает на рабочих станциях и серверах семейства R... DB2 2. Эта реализация SQL для персональных компьютеров компании IBM основана ...
С тех пор оба продукта были перенесены на множество других платформ. Кроме того, поставщики мини-компьютеров разрабатывали на основе SQL со... Компания Digital на каждую систему VAX VMS устанавливала собственную С... В начале 80-х уже были доступны четыре большие СУБД для UNIX-систем. На сегодняшний день существуют версии СУБД компаний Oracle, Sybase, In...
SQL и обработка транзакций. В процессе своего развития SQL и реляционные базы данных почти не прим... Поскольку в реляционных базах данных упор делается на запросы, такие б... В 1986 году компания Sybase, новая на рынке СУБД, представила реляцион... В апреле 1988 года компания IBM присоединилась к поставщикам реляционн...
В январе 1988 года Microsoft и Ashton-Tate неожиданно объявили, что он... Сделав SQL частью операционной системы, компания IBM тем самым вновь п... SQL на персональных компьютерах. Первые СУБД для персональных компьютеров представляли собой соответств... С появлением первой модели IBM PC базы данных стали приобретать популя...
– Конец работы –
Используемые теги: Реляционные, базы, данных, SQL, стандартный, язык, реляционных, баз, данных0.129
Если Вам нужно дополнительный материал на эту тему, или Вы не нашли то, что искали, рекомендуем воспользоваться поиском по нашей базе работ: Реляционные Базы Данных. SQL - стандартный язык реляционных баз данных
Если этот материал оказался полезным для Вас, Вы можете сохранить его на свою страничку в социальных сетях:
Твитнуть |
Новости и инфо для студентов